Specialized Treatment Plans in Pennsylvania
Every person requires a unique approach to healing from mental illness or substance abuse. A dedicated therapist in West Chester works with you to create personalized treatment plans that address your specific goals. For some, an outpatient program offers the flexibility to maintain work and family commitments while receiving help. Others might require inpatient treatment at professional treatment centers to ensure a safe environment. Your provider will help you navigate the various levels of care available for drug and alcohol concerns.
